We catch up with award-winning designer Frank Chimero on Co-founding the software company Abstract, how typography brings meaning to mobile experiences, his go-to tools, looking into CSS frameworks for temporary scaffolding prototyping, and working through design expectations vs accessibility and usability with clients.

One of the nice things about most traffic coming through mobile is that there is a very nice purity and reliance on typography which I really like because I trained as a print designer, typography was the first thing I loved about that, so developing type systems and relying on type to try to communicate hierarchy structure and nuance and meaning, where it might be very difficult to explain pictorially, I think is a big change in terms of what seems to work better in a mobile context.
